>I appears there is a leak in the sunroof area of my latest Audi, the 89 80.
>The back half of the headliner is shot, and the area behind the drivers
>seat is wet (and the only source of recent water that could have caused it
>is me washing the car.)  I assume the drain tube is leaking or clogged on
>the rear drivers side of the sunroof.

No BTDT with the headliner material, but somewhere in one of the Bentley
manuals I have there was mention of clearing the sunroof drains by feeding
a length of something like speedometer cable innards through the
drains.  I'd start by using the plastic whip material from a weedwhip.   I
THINK all the Audi sunroofs have a drain for each corner.  The fronts
usually end up in the front doorjambs and the rears usually exit in the
rear wheelwells.  The Bentley described inserting the cleaning tool from
the bottom.
